## Authentication

The Thimbleway tile prefetcher pulls map tiles from the internal Cartwheel render farm on a nightly schedule. All requests must carry a bearer credential scoped to the prefetch role; anonymous requests are dropped at the edge. Rotation happens quarterly. If the nightly job fails with a 401, restart it with the current key, shown below.

gateway credential: kto23_LX9A4ys6i4nzHtpOLNLodKK

Hi Rostan,

Before I rotate off, a careful summary of the Pictavault leak. The thumbnail cache in the Orvelle render tier never evicts entries whose source row was soft-deleted, so RSS climbs roughly 40 MB/hour under normal load. Mireille's patch adds a sweep job, but it needs the audit schema applied first — see migration 0492. Watch pg_stat_activity for the sweeper; it should never hold a lock longer than two seconds. The sweep job reads from the metadata replica using the connection string below.

primary connection of tajeg-tajop = postgresql://julax_svc:DI@db-e7f3.kelvidyn.corp:5432/rusdor

## Runbook: Payment retry idempotency check

Before approving the Centavo release, confirm that retry handlers reuse idempotency keys rather than generating new ones per attempt. Duplicate charges in the last cycle traced back to key regeneration. Verify by querying the idempotency table directly, connecting with the connection string below.

warehouse DSN: mssql://rusdor_svc:0FSWCn9@db-951a.paliqforge.local:5432/ulawyn

### Onboarding: WebSocket Compression on Fernmarch

We enable permessage-deflate selectively: it cuts bandwidth roughly 60% on chat payloads but raises CPU and memory per connection, which matters at Fernmarch's scale. Binary telemetry frames stay uncompressed. Tuning lives in the Saltwick config service; changing it requires unlocking the staging config vault with the recovery passphrase below.

vault phrase of kawep-tahog = ulaix-briath

## Onboarding: Farebranch Rules Engine

Plugin authors integrate with Farebranch by registering fee rules against the evaluation API. Rules are sandboxed; they cannot perform network calls directly. All rate-table lookups go through the host, which validates your plugin manifest at load time. Your local env file must include the signing credential the host uses to verify manifests, set on the next line.

secret setting of bajef-fajof: COURIER_KEY3=76c